Use a synthetic-bristle brush for latex paint and a natural-bristle brush for oil-based paint. Since wood is porous, the paint soaks in a little, creating a shallow bond with the wood, unlike materials such as plastic that require special paints or primers to get the paint to adhere. A quality exterior acrylic paint is the best choice for exterior wood surfaces for a variety of reasons. A flat or satin latex will give you smoother coverage and won’t require frequent cleaning to look good, but you need to start with a smooth surface that has been well-sanded. For decorative wooden trims with scrollwork or other ornate decorations in crown moulding, choose a latex paint that will more easily get into the grooves and recesses of the wooden pattern. If you paint raw wood with unbonded Milk paint, the paint will soak right into the wood, creating a lovely, soft, aged look. You can choose between matte (flat), eggshell, satin, semi-gloss, and high-gloss options, listed here in order from lowest to highest luster.
